Abstract: A power transmission system (100) for transmitting power from a crank shaft (112) of an engine (110) to a drive shaft (122) of a transmission gear box (120) via a clutch assembly (130) is disclosed. The clutch assembly facilitates co-rotation and relative rotation of the crank and drive shafts when engaged and not engaged, respectively. The system includes an electric motor (142) with an input/output shaft (148) and a gear assembly (146) coupled to the input/output and drive shafts. Rotation of the drive shaft is transmitted to rotation of the input/output shaft via the gear assembly and rotation of the input/output shaft is transmitted to rotation of the drive shaft via the gear assembly. The crank shaft drives the drive shaft when the clutch assembly is engaged and the electric motor drives the drive shaft when the clutch assembly is not engaged.

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for comparing a fuel consumption of a first vehicle with a second vehicle, which first vehicle has a first energy converter in the form of a combustion engine to generate a first driving force for propulsion of said first vehicle, and at least a second energy converter in the form of a first electrical machine to generate a second driving force for propulsion of said vehicle. The method comprises, at a first point in time, where said first and second vehicles are driven in the same way: - using determination means to determine a difference in fuel consumption between said first vehicle and said second vehicle, said second vehicle having only one energy converter to generate driving force for its propulsion, in the form of a combustion engine which is substantially identical with said first combustion engine.

Abstract: An automatic transmission for a hybrid vehicle includes a hydraulic circuit (110) having a source of pressurized fluid (112), an actuation circuit (114) that delivers pressurized fluid to actuate components of the transmission, and a cooling circuit (116) used to cool components of the transmission. The source of pressurized fluid includes a first pump (134) that is operatively driven by the internal combustion engine of the hybrid vehicle and a second pump (136) that is operatively driven by the electric motor (138). The second pump (136) acts to supply pressurized fluid to the cooling circuit (116) when the first pump (134) is operatively driven by the internal combustion engine under certain predetermined conditions.

Abstract: A suspension module that includes a suspension component, a pair of wheel hubs coupled to the at least one suspension component and an auxiliary drive system. Each wheel hub is mounted to a vehicle wheel. The auxiliary drive system has a pair of drive units, an auxiliary battery, an auxiliary battery charger and a controller. Each of the drive units has an electric motor that is selectively operable for providing drive torque that is transmitted to an associated one of the wheel hubs. The controller is configured to operate in a first mode wherein an output of the auxiliary battery charger is employed to charge the auxiliary battery. The controller is also configured to operate in a second mode wherein the output of the auxiliary battery charger and an output of the auxiliary battery are employed to power the electric motors of the drive units.

Abstract: A hybrid energy conversion system is described which utilizes a drive engine configured to output mechanical energy at a generally uniform rotational speed under varying mechanical load conditions. The mechanical energy is used to turn an electrical generator mechanically coupled to the drive engine. The electrical energy output from the electrical generator is then used to power an electrical motor coupled to a mechanical load.

Abstract: An electric hybrid system having an internal combustion engine and a electric motor where the electric hybrid system includes a boost device and at least one electric storage device. The boost device is operatively connected to the internal combustion engine. The at least one electric storage device is in operative electrical communication with the boost device and the electric motor for selectively providing power by way of a controller to the electric motor or the boost device. The controller selects the electric motor, the internal combustion engine or boost assist and internal combination engine combinations for powering of a vehicle or other machine based on predetermined operator demand conditions.

Abstract: A drive device with electronic circuit, comprising a floated wiring (Ws) for electrically connecting the solid wirings (Ss) of a circuit to each other and an electronic circuit (M) mechanically connected to an engine, wherein the electronic circuit is formed so that the flat surface thereof including the floated wiring (flat surface in X-Z axis direction) is substantially disposed vertically relative to the output axis (Y-axis) of the engine, whereby the vibration of the engine in the major X- and Z-directions can be prevented from applying to the floated wiring in Y-axis direction to increase the seismic resistance of the electronic circuit, and the arrangement of the drive device having the electronic circuit mechanically installed thereon can be realized.
